NIBE to acquire WaterFurnace

SWEDEN: Heat pump manufacturer NIBE is to acquire US geothermal heat pump heating and cooling solutions company WaterFurnace in a $378m deal.

WaterFurnace will continue to operate as a separate entity under the leadership of ceo Tom Huntington and his management team. NIBE intends to develop the business as a growth platform in North America.

Gerteric
NIBE ceo Gerteric Lindquist

“This transaction is NIBE’s largest to date in North America and further elevates our position as one of the global market leaders in sustainable energy solutions,” said NIBE ceo Gerteric Lindquist.

“Following our successful expansion of our Elements Division in the United States, the teaming up with WaterFurnace represents a strategic match and bridgehead into North America also for our largest business area Energy Systems. We are pleased to see that both groups share the same entrepreneurial tradition and technological vision, being one of the first companies to market geothermal heat pump solutions on respective sides of the Atlantic.”

Founded in 1983, WaterFurnace is a premier US geothermal heat pump brand. The company’s product offering includes a range of geothermal heat pumps, smart control systems, hot water storage tanks and indoor air  quality solutions.

Products are marketed under the WaterFurnace and GeoStar brands in North America, and the WFI brand via a joint venture in China. Net sales were $119m last year, with 70% of sales in the residential sector.
